A variation of the 1968 Topps Game cards. These are B&W and have been purposely "distressed" much like distressed furniture, kitchen cabinets, jeans and other things that have enjoyed popularity in some circles. I can only assume Topps creators/designers were really digging deep to come up with this idea!
This collection came from a longtime collector, these cards are definitely precision cut, not hand cut, and match up perfectly with each other as well as the issued version of 1968 game cards. Backing is some sort of faux grained leather type material.
This group consists of 18 different subjects with a few duplicates.
In comparing duplicates you can see the "creases" are not creases but rather "printed" on the card. See the Gene Alley card below and note the same major crease running from his helmet down through his left cheek to his neck. And another out of his right nostril and one above his right eyebrow to mention a few. The same holds true for all the other cards.
